Ah, Convention Season
It's CON SEASON.  Not rabbit season, not duck season, but CONVENTION SEASON.  That time when a fan-boy/girl's fancies turn to milling around convention centers across the country, looking for loot, checking out displays, and simply fanning.  For once, you are among comrades, equals, compatriots.  Mundanes, you know who you are, beware.  Bwahahahahahahahahahahahahahahahahaha.  .... sorry, lost control for a sec.  Anyway, what exactly is the big deal?

1.  See the good stuff IN PERSON.  Ok, so you dont' have $1000 to blow on Star Convoy, mint-in-box.  Still, this is the closest you'll get to see the REAL stuff, beyond staring at another catalog scan(By the way, I've seen it at a con, it's unfortunately not all that impressive in person.). 

2. Neat, CHEAP stuff.  Not all of us has $400 to snag the full-sized version of
Great Goldran.  Very cool toy, but rent is kinda important.  Well, I wandered through a con, and guess what, I found a smaller version for $10.00.  Ok, so it's not as detailed, has only 1/2 the transformations, and is only 7" high.  However, for $10, I hav a decent version of Great Goldran that still separates into it's three base parts with a ton o' extra weapons to mess with.  The lesson?  You can always find neat, AFFORDABLE stuff at a con.  Besides, you really wanna explain what's in that monster-sized box at the x-ray machine at the airport?  Didn't think so.

3. Networking.  Best chance to get business cards for other shops, hook-up with other collectors, and talk to big-wigs at companies if you're really ambitious. 

4. Show me the money.  If you feel like being a capitalist, getting a table at a con can be a good way to score bucks on the pieces in your collection you can bare to part with.

5. The Anime Room.  Considering the cost of anime, and the hassle to rent/borrow, this is a great chance to sample all sorts of stuff.  I became hooked on 'cowboy BeeBop', and FINALLY saw 'Ghost in the Shell' while at an anime room(If you're wondering, the hype is well deserved in both cases.)
